Here is the unedited script for a children's picture book (Use your imagination and make the nosies out loud it is best that way!!!)


Synopsis: Animal Orchestra
When you are put bed, do you wonder what happens down stairs?
In this house, when Jack tries to sleep elephants, walruses, hippos, and gibbons all come round to play music.  Will Jack ever get to sleep? 
Animal Orchestra
“Good night Jack. Sleep well.”
Briiiing, Briiiing. A hoof on a door bell.
There on the step are five Grevy’s Zebras each carrying a violin.
Come in.
Sitting on the sofa they start to tune up: Screeech, Hoooowl, HUMMMMMM.
Will you keep the noise down!!!!! I can’t sleep with all that noise!!!!
Tap-tap-tap on the door.
“Can I come in?” asks the White Rhino  with a Double Bass
Rhino tunes up, too. Dum Dum Dum, Screeech, Hoooowl, HUMMMMMM.
Will you keep the noise down!!!!! I can’t sleep with all that noise!!!!
Rat-at-at, Rat-at-at, Rat-at-at on the door.  An elephant with drums and cymbals.
The African Elephant tunes up. Boom boom tap tish tish, Dum Dum Dum, Screeech, Hoooowl, HUMMMMMM.
Will you keep the noise down!!!!! I can’t sleep with all that noise!!!!
Thud slap splat on the door. 
There on the step are three Walruses with trumpets and a Blue Ringed  octopus with a triangle.
Walruses start to blow. Toot Toooooooottttttttttttttttttttt. TING TING ting goes the octopus.  Boom boom tap tish tish, Dum Dum Dum, Screeech, Hoooowl, HUMMMMM.
Will you keep the noise down!!!!! I can’t sleep with all that noise!!!!
Snap snap scratch on the door.
There on the step are two Gharial Crocodiles carrying trombones.
The crocodiles pucker up and Parp Paaaaaaaaarrrrrrrrrppppppp!  Paaaaaaaarrrrrrrrrp! Toot Toooooooottttttttttttttttttttt, TING TING ting, Boom boom tap tish tish, Dum Dum Dum, Screeech, Hoooowl, HUMMMMM.
Will you keep the noise down!!!!! I can’t sleep with all that noise!!!!
Plunk Plunk Plunk Thud on the door.
There on the step are four Lar Gibbons with guitar cases and three hippos in high heels and sequinned dresses.
Gloria, Geraldine, and Grace warm up their vocal cords. Laaaaaaaaaa, Laaaaaaaaa, Laaaaaaaaaaaa, Laaaaaaaaaaa, The Lar Gibbons get ready, Strumm plink plink Struuuuuum, plink, Parp Paaaaaaaaarrrrrrrrrppppppp!  Paaaaaaaarrrrrrrrrp! Toot Toooooooottttttttttttttttttttt, TING TING ting, Boom boom tap tish tish, Dum Dum Dum, Screeech, Hoooowl, HUMMMM.
Will you keep the noise down!!!!! I can’t sleep with all that noise!!!!
A gentle tap of dad’ s conductors baton brings  silence. He raises his hands.
Ahhhh Now I can sleep.
ZZZZZZ PUPPHH!! ZZZZZZ PUPPHH!! ZZZZZZ PUPPHH!! ZZZZZZ PUPPHH!!
Gloria, Geraldine, and Grace the hippos, the Lar Gibbons, gharial Crocodiles, walruses,  Blue ringed octopus, African elephant, white rhino and the Grevy’s zebras all drop their instruments and cover their ears.
We can’t play with all that noise!!!!!!!!!!!!!
